Senate elections: Government decides to bring constitutional amendment to end horse trading

ISLAMABAD: The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) government has decided to bring a constitutional amendment to end horse trading in the Senate elections.

Talking to media along with Federal Minister for Education Shafqat Mahmood, Azam Swati said that he wanted to hold the next Senate elections through show of hands. Recommendations have been made in the cabinet to make the election process transparent.

He said that all possible steps are being taken for transparent elections. Penalties have been proposed for those who interfere in the electoral process. The government is working on a reform agenda. The legal bills we have introduced are pending in the Senate.

On this occasion, Shafqat Mahmood said that the purpose of all things is to make the election transparent. The Senate wants to bring elections and reforms by consensus.

He said that the Senate was bringing constitutional amendments to end horse trading in the elections. Under the proposed recommendations, any candidate will be able to object to the staff of the Election Commission.

Shafqat Mahmood said that under the new recommendations, it would be necessary to finalize the constituencies four months before the elections.
